Set the Stage and lead Mr. President
Mr. President you tried to set the stage on tax reform with your last State of the Union and the Tax panel you set up.
Unfortunately, that panel "Failed" at their task and like Donald Trump you should say "They're Fired!"
In your 2006 State of the Union - frame the tax reform debate further. Tell the American People you are narrowing the focus to 3 possibilities for reform. And that you want the American people to truly consider if they want a status quo tax system that is full of lobbyist loopholes or do you want something better for American Families; American Workers and better for the American economy.
Say in your 2006 State of the Union that
" in the area of major tax reform, some good work has been done but it is time for the American people and its elected officials to take a much more serious look at America's economic future and success.
I beleive there are 3 possible areas of tax reform that would be best for American Families, American Business and the American Economy. The Old IRS Code is like a tired old car; Our American Economy needs to trade it in for a new tax code that gets better gas mileage and costs less in repairs. Only the mechanics(lobbyists and Congress) are getting wealthy on this old tax code.
Of the three possible Solutions for a newer tax code.
One is O.K.; the second is better and the third may be best."
Mr. President, tell the American People that
" the Tax panel laid a good first step(cough, cough) but it does not answer all I asked for.
The Second choice may be a true flat tax but that still leaves a very regressive Payroll tax on the Middle Class and does not do enough for us to fight outsourcing, encourage job growth, encourage economic growth or promote an Ownership Society.
Alan Greenspan and over 75 Economists have spoken positively about a consumption tax. A few like the VAT and most like a Sales Tax as a better way to encourage our economy. A VAT has more problems than a National Sales tax and a VAT is a problematic system seen in Europe that I would rather not follow.
The third choice may be the best choice. We can make a National Sales tax system Progressive and positive for our American Economy and let American FAmilies take home 100% of their paychecks with no Federal withdrawals. We can widen the tax base for both the Federal Budget and Soical Security and Medicare.
2 of the top 20 Economies in the world operate on a Sales tax for over 95% of their operations and Government Expenses. Florida and Texas. Over 45 States already have Sales Tax systems that could adjust and work with a National Sales Tax. it is much easier to track and manage than an Income tax system.
A lot of good research has gone into a plan supported by many National Organizations; including the AFFT- Americans for Fair Taxation, NTU-National Taxpayers Union and many others. That Plan may have the answer to replacing our archaic Income tax code. The Plan is called the Fair Tax and is Sponsored in Congress by Congressman John Linder. HR25.
It is currently in Congress awaiting more discussion. The Fair Tax is like a new Car for our economy; it is streamlined, easy to operate and will be a great help to American families and American workers. In Fact, one supporter said it is the tax plan that will "Supercharge our economy" and many Economists agree.
One thing is for sure our current tax code is an old junker that Congress just keeps tinkering with. The Problem is that Congress has turned the current tax code into a rust bucket that runs over our American Economy, encourages outsourcing and offshore investment, feeds the trade deficit and fails to Tax our Economy and Families Fairly.
Before 1913, we did not have the income tax system you see today. The American Economy was taxed using consumption taxes primarily.
The time has come for us to think about our American future in light of a Global economy. In this new century we need a tax system that fits the 21st Century, a tax system that can promote good paying jobs and economic growth that benefits American working Families here at home.
The Third choice may be the best choice but that will take discussion with the American people and Congress. Know that many in Congress and the Lobbyists that support them will hate it but that is a sign that it is a good thing."
Mr. President , you say this and Americans will follow.
